There are three types of hinges made from upvc which are standard hinges, restor hinges and fire escape hinges. The only difference between them is that hinges that are fire escape allow for a full 90-degree opening and conform to Approved Document B in the UK Building Regulations. Restrictor hinges offer the ability to open more tightly, however they are still adequate for ventilation and can be used with both top and side-hung windows.

When determining the correct size hinge for your windows made of upvc it is important to consider the track's outer width (18mm in H01) and hinge thickness (13mm - 17mm) and the length of the arm (flat - 13mm & kinked – 17mm). Use the first hole on the track or the arm since it is closest to the original. If the holes do not line up the new upvc hinges can be fixed using a screw repair pack (available on the web site) to fill the holes that were originally drilled and ensure a proper fit.
